Edo PDP gives new revelation as Obaseki dumps APC

Edo State chapter of the People’s Democratic Party has said the embattled Governor of the state, Godwin Obaseki, and other top officials of the All Progressives Congress, would soon join his party.

The Chairman of the party, Mr Tony Aziegbemi, made the statement as Obaseki formally announced his decision to resign his membership of the ruling APC.

Obaseki was on Friday disqualified from contesting the party’s governorship primary election by the screening committee on the ground of certificate discrepancies.

He thereafter made the announcement to quit the party after meeting with President Muhammadu Buhari at the Presidential Villa, Abuja, on Tuesday

Noting that Obaseki will not be given an automatic ticket in PDP, Aziegbemi said the governor can contest with other candidates who had earlier shown interest.

He said the party had been in touch with the governor and the date he would join the PDP will be confirmed soon.

Meanwhile, the PDP has fixed its governorship primary for June 19 and 20.
